通道巡航控制。
使用 POST 方式发起请求。
下表仅列出了接口特有的请求参数和部分公共参数。完整的公共参数列表,参考「公共参数」。
字段 | 位置 | 类型 | 必填 | 说明 | 值 |
---|---|---|---|---|---|
Action | Query | String | 是 | 公共参数,OpenAPI 接口名称 | CruiseControl |
Version | Query | String | 是 | 公共参数,OpenAPI 接口版本 | 2021-01-01 |
字段 | 类型 | 必填 | 说明 |
---|---|---|---|
DeviceNSID | String | 是 | 设备国标 ID,可通过调用 ListDevices 接口获取 |
ChannelID | String | 是 | 设备通道 ID,可通过调用 ListStreams 接口获取 |
Action | String | 是 | 巡航指令,可选枚举值包括:
|
TrackID | Number | 是 | 巡航组编号,取值范围:[1, 255] |
PresetID | Number | 否 | 预置位编号,取值范围:[0, 255],适用于 Add 和 Remove 指令;当 Action=Remove 且 PresetID=0 时, 表示删除 TrackID 对应的整条巡航路径 |
Speed | Number | 否 | 巡航速度,取值范围:[1, 4095],适用于 SetSpeed 指令 |
StaySeconds | Number | 否 | 预置位停留时间,单位:秒,[1~4095],取值范围:[1, 4095],适用于 SetStay 指令 |
通用返回参数,请参考 ResponseMetadata 结构体说明。
POST https://open.volcengineapi.com?Action=CruiseControl &Version=2021-01-01 &<公共请求参数> { "DeviceNSID": "340200379911xxxxxxxx", "ChannelID": "340200000013xxxxxxxx", "Action": "SetSpeed", "TrackID": 1, "Speed": 200 }
{ "ResponseMetadata": { "RequestId": "202112081549400102121450322701D9BA", "Action": "CruiseControl", "Version": "2021-01-01", "Service": "aiotvideo", "Region": "cn-north-1" } }